X-Git-Url: https://git.madduck.net/etc/awesome.git/blobdiff_plain/ee627f468c6f390534c551f7bc6fa1c55e4772f5..609b11882958381f668e25316ba1b575fd1096af:/Utilities.md?ds=sidebyside diff --git a/Utilities.md b/Utilities.md index 4fc80e4..cbf8c0f 100644 --- a/Utilities.md +++ b/Utilities.md @@ -1,11 +1,9 @@ -[<- home](https://github.com/copycat-killer/lain/wiki) - markup ------ This is a submodule which helps you markupping your text. -First, call it like this: +First, require it like this: local markup = require("lain.util.markup") @@ -40,13 +38,19 @@ then you can call its functions: |`-- normal() Set both foreground and background normal colors. `-- urgent() Set both foreground and background urgent colors. +they all take one argument, which is the text to markup, except `fg.color` and `bg.color`: + + markup.fg.color(text, color) + markup.bg.color(text, color) + menu\_clients\_current\_tags ---------------------------- Similar to `awful.menu.clients()`, but this menu only shows the clients of currently visible tags. Use it with a key binding like this: - awful.key({ "Mod1" }, "Tab", function() + awful.key({ "Mod1" }, "Tab", + function() awful.menu.menu_keys.down = { "Down", "Alt_L", "Tab", "j" } awful.menu.menu_keys.up = { "Up", "k" } lain.util.menu_clients_current_tags({ width = 350 }, { keygrabber = true })